Cable Television Providers

Cable providers have long been a staple in home entertainment. They typically offer a broad range of channels, including premium networks, sports packages, and local channels. With high-quality video and reliable service, cable remains popular among viewers who enjoy traditional television experiences. However, it often comes with higher monthly fees compared to other options.

Satellite Television Providers

Satellite television is another well-established option that delivers programming through satellites orbiting the Earth. This method allows access even in remote areas where cable might not be available. Satellite services often feature extensive channel lineups and bundled packages that include movies and sports networks. Nevertheless, they can face challenges such as weather-related interruptions.

Internet Protocol Television (IPTV)

IPTV utilizes internet connections to deliver television content directly to devices like smart TVs or computers. This technology enables features such as video on demand, time-shifting capabilities, and interactive applications for an enhanced user experience. As we consider IPTV providers in conjunction with those listed earlier, it’s important to evaluate factors like bandwidth requirements which can affect performance.

1. Basic Channels

These typically include local networks, such as ABC, NBC, CBS, and FOX, which provide essential news and entertainment programming. A solid foundation of basic channels is crucial for viewers who prioritize staying updated on current events or enjoy popular shows.

2. Premium Networks

Many providers offer premium channels like HBO, Showtime, or Starz as part of their packages or for an additional fee. Accessing these networks can significantly enhance our viewing options with original series, films, and exclusive documentaries that are often not available elsewhere.

3. Specialty Channels

Specialty channels cater to niche interests-think sports networks (ESPN), lifestyle (HGTV), or educational content (National Geographic). Depending on our personal preferences, having a wide range of specialty channels allows us to explore new topics and indulge in hobbies from the comfort of our homes.
